Florida Man Gets 15 Years in Trio of Jewelry Store Robberies
The 50-year-old man pleaded guilty earlier this year to robbing two jewelry stores and a pawn shop of more than $700,000 in merchandise.

According to the U.S. Attorney’s Office in Jacksonville, Florida, Michael Deon Woulard pleaded guilty to robbery and two counts of brandishing a firearm in furtherance of a violent crime in March.
He was sentenced to 14 years and 10 months behind bars on Friday, the minimum he could have received for his crimes. He also was ordered to pay $442,583 in restitution.
According to court documents and proceedings in the case, between October 2023 and February 2024, Woulard robbed two Kay Jewelers stores and a Value Pawn shop, netting about $760,000.
Prosecutors said he robbed the Value Pawn in Jacksonville, Florida, on Oct. 10, 2023, stealing $45,945 in goods.
On Nov. 25, Woulard robbed a Kay Jewelers store in Jacksonville, pointing a semi-automatic pistol at employees and stealing $352,624 in jewelry.
He robbed another Kay Jewelers store in early 2024, this one in Ocala, Florida, again pulling out a gun and making off with about $364,753 in jewelry.
Police arrested Woulard on Feb. 21, 2024.
He was in possession of numerous pieces of jewelry stolen during the third robbery and admitted to committing the jewelry store robberies in a voluntary interview, prosecutors said.
Woulard had a co-defendant in the case, Erica Jordan Patrick.
She pleaded guilty to two counts of aiding and abetting the November 2025 robbery.
According to prosecutors, she cased the store prior to the robbery and identified pieces and showcases for Woulard to target.
Court records show that Patrick, who provided information that led to Woulard’s arrest and the recovery of the guns used in the robberies, entered her plea Wednesday.
She received five years of probation.
